  15. AHudson

    NSX 'clunk' in rear

    Had a loudish clunk in the rear of my 1998 and after reading many threads, determined it was shocks. Bought a like new pair of Bilsteins from fellow Prime member, took the car to Acura for installation. NSX tech says, "Nope, not the shocks" and proceeds to replace two worn lower bushings and...
